Refinery Coordinator - Marshall, MN

This is a full-time, exempt position.

Job Summary

Responsible for the coordination and communication of day-to-day operations within the Refinery department.

Essential Job Functions

  • Ensure the safety of all operations colleagues through:

  • Encouraging colleagues to work safely with environmental awareness and good manufacturing practices in mind.

  • Compliance with occupational safety and health standards and regulations.

  • Provide recommendations for improvements to company facilities, equipment, and safety programs.

  • Communicate daily operations needs with maintenance, I/E, contracting groups, and other departments.

  • Provide indirect supervision of all Refinery colleagues and direct supervision of Day Operators.

  • Provide consistent and immediate feedback on area performance utilizing direct personal contact and document feedback in performance notes.

  • Identify training needs for current colleagues, provide training to new hires, and work with employees in developing a high level of skill and job proficiency.

  • Assist in the hiring process and development of Plant Utility and OIT colleagues.

  • Assists with the management of area construction and expansion projects.

  • Address production limiting factors and repeating problems in addition to identifying problems and taking steps to eliminate them.

  • Aid in the management of the department in keeping with established policies, procedures and plant priorities.

  • Assist in leading department in a manner that results in a cohesive, focused, positive climate to achieve organizational goals.

  • Provide daily leadership, guidance, and directions designed to set the Refinery teams up for success after normal working hours and on weekends.

  • Share on call duties within the department, modify work schedule for special projects, and provide shift leadership coverage on an as needed basis.

  • Additional Duties as assigned.

Job Requirements

  • Must be a current Shift Supervisor or Superintendent (required)

  • 5+ years of experience in leadership role in process related position (preferred)

  • Demonstrated strong commitment to and leadership in plant safety, quality, and environmental programs.

  • Excellent communication skills - both oral and written.

  • Technical competence in process operations, mechanics, instrumentation, controls, calculations, and utility systems.

  • Ability to manage multiple ongoing tasks, meet deadlines, and strive for continuous improvement.

  • Ability to utilize independent judgment to solve problems and establish priorities.

  • Computer proficiency and basic knowledge of DCS and PI software

Working Conditions

  • Dust

  • Chemicals / Irritants

  • The scope of the position may have exposure to and use of chemicals, solvents, and cleaners that may be hazardous and/or cause injury if specific instructions regarding their mixture, use, and disposal/storage are not properly followed.

  • Inside areas:

  • Spring / Summer: Temperatures in some areas of the facility will be up to or exceed 100 degrees

  • Fall / Winter: Temperatures in the facility may be at or below freezing.

  • Outside areas:

  • Spring / Summer: Outside temperature may be up to or exceed 100 degrees with potential for high humidity. May be exposed to inclement weather conditions including, but not limited to, rain and wind.

  • Fall / Winter: Outside temperatures may reach freezing or below. May be exposed to inclement weather including, freezing rain, sleet, snow and wind.

  • Some manufacturing processes within the facility are highly reliant on machinery and other processing equipment and, as a result, noise levels may reach or exceed 85 decibels and require use of hearing protection for most of the work shift.

Physical Requirements

  • Must be able to lift up to 25lbs from waist to shoulder on an occasional basis

  • No push/pull requirement

  • Must be able to walk 1-4 hours

  • Must be able to sit 5-8 hours

  • Must be able to squat/kneel on an occasional basis

  • Must be able to climb stairs/ladders on an occasional basis

  • Constant computer/keyboarding
